One more from the archives on Cuban jazz—-and this might be the best of the lot! You’ll hear how Castro’s disdain for anything American led him to ‘ban’ jazz, and how this led to a new and revolutionary form of music: timba. Chucho Valdes and Iraquere played quite a role in that development.

I also play excerpts of a conversation I had with Arturo O’Farrill in Havana, and two tracks from an album he did with Chucho Valdes.

You’ll also hear The Cuban Funk Machine, Okan, Bobby Carcassess, Sexto Sentido, and a young pianist who will blow you away: Jorge Luis Pacheco.
